This elevated seat is specially designed to meet the needs of those who have undergone unilateral or bilateral total hip replacement. When the patient is seated on it, the legs are kept abducted in the proper position. The "saddle" type seat also prevents internal rotation as well as adduction at the hip. This can help reduce the effects of spasticity occuring in persons with cerebral palsy or other conditions affecting muscle tone. Adds 4" to the seating level. Weighs 3.3 lb. (1.5 kg). Designed in conjunction with the OT/PT Rehabilitation Departments at the Hospital for Special Surgery in New York, NY.
